The Day of the Disaster

On October 29, 2018, the world watched in horror as news broke about Lion Air Flight 610, a Boeing 737 MAX 8, that tragically crashed shortly after taking off from Jakarta, Indonesia, en route to Pangkal Pinang. Imagine the scene: just minutes after leaving the ground, the plane plummeted into the Java Sea. There were no survivors; all 189 people on board, including passengers and crew, lost their lives. It was a heartbreaking moment, and the scale of the loss was simply devastating. The initial reports were incredibly alarming, and the subsequent investigation was launched to find out what went wrong. The crash immediately raised serious questions about the aircraft's safety, the procedures in place, and what could have been done to prevent such a tragedy. The impact of this event went way beyond the immediate loss of life. It triggered a global crisis of confidence in the 737 MAX 8 and led to a worldwide grounding of the aircraft type. This had massive repercussions for airlines, manufacturers, and the flying public, all of whom were now deeply concerned about the safety of air travel. The Lion Air crash investigation quickly became one of the most significant and complex investigations in recent aviation history. Its findings would lead to major changes in the industry.

Unraveling the Causes: What Went Wrong?

Alright, let's get into the nitty-gritty of the causes of the Lion Air crash. The investigation revealed a series of factors that, when combined, led to the disaster. At the heart of it all was a malfunctioning sensor. The aircraft's Angle of Attack (AoA) sensor provided incorrect data to the MCAS. This sensor is crucial; it tells the plane's computer the angle between the wing and the oncoming air. Based on this information, the MCAS would automatically push the nose of the aircraft down to prevent a stall. But when the AoA sensor sent false data, the MCAS activated inappropriately, repeatedly pushing the nose down even though the pilots were trying to counter it. Think about the pilots in the cockpit, desperately fighting to control the plane, but being undermined by a faulty system. It was a terrifying situation. The pilots struggled to understand what was happening, and the speed with which the events unfolded left them little time to react effectively. They followed procedures as best they could, but they were hampered by the lack of clear information and the overwhelming force of the MCAS. The rapid descent and the continuous battle for control overwhelmed them, and, tragically, they couldn't recover the aircraft in time. It's a heartbreaking story of human effort against technological failure.

But the problem wasn't just the faulty sensor and the MCAS. The investigation pointed to other critical factors, too. There were issues with the aircraft's maintenance and the training that the pilots received. Apparently, the sensor had problems on previous flights, and this wasn't properly addressed. In addition, the pilots were not adequately informed about the MCAS system and how it could affect the plane's handling. This lack of knowledge made it incredibly difficult for them to respond effectively when the system malfunctioned. The combination of these issues created a perfect storm of failure, with a faulty sensor, a poorly understood system, and inadequate training all playing a part in the tragedy. The Impact: Consequences and Changes

The impact of the Lion Air Flight 610 crash was enormous. The immediate consequence, of course, was the loss of 189 lives. But the repercussions extended far beyond this tragedy. The crash triggered a global crisis for Boeing and the 737 MAX 8. The aircraft was grounded worldwide, causing significant disruption for airlines that operated the plane. Boeing faced intense scrutiny and had to take steps to address the issues raised by the investigation. The crash eroded public trust in the 737 MAX 8 and raised serious questions about the certification process for aircraft. Airlines had to find ways to deal with the absence of these planes, rescheduling flights, and incurring additional costs. The grounding affected travel plans for millions of passengers. Boeing worked on fixes to the MCAS and other systems, and the plane was eventually recertified, but not before suffering huge financial and reputational damage. The event led to an industry-wide review of aircraft safety and the procedures for certifying new aircraft. The Lion Air crash had significant financial ramifications for all involved, from Boeing to the airlines to the families affected by the tragedy. The crash prompted numerous investigations and lawsuits, and the financial impact on those directly and indirectly involved was enormous.

But it wasn't just about financial losses. The crash forced the aviation industry to seriously rethink safety protocols, pilot training, and aircraft certification. Regulators worldwide took a closer look at the certification process, and new guidelines were introduced. Boeing made changes to the MCAS system, and pilot training was updated to include scenarios related to MCAS malfunctions. Airlines reviewed their maintenance procedures, and there was a renewed emphasis on transparency and communication within the industry. Pilot training was updated to include more intensive instruction on how to handle the MCAS and other potential system failures. The crash also led to improvements in the way that flight data is analyzed and shared, making it easier for investigators to identify potential safety issues.
